undercloud hosts record is added only for node holding ContainersPrepare service
Bug #1871243 reported by
Lukas Bezdicka
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
tripleo |
Fix Released
|
Medium
|
Lukas Bezdicka |
Bug Description
The record for undercloud in /etc/hosts is added only on controlller role - the role holding ContainerPrepare service. This makes any other node to fail to fetch images from the undercloud.
Changed in tripleo: | |
assignee: | nobody → Lukas Bezdicka (social-b) |
status: | New → In Progress |
Changed in tripleo: | |
importance: | Undecided → Medium |
To post a comment you must log in.
Reviewed: https:/ /review. opendev. org/717872 /git.openstack. org/cgit/ openstack/ tripleo- heat-templates/ commit/ ?id=fff8cf73c6a 4d0e311b8b02036 e7df928b998339
Committed: https:/
Submitter: Zuul
Branch: master
commit fff8cf73c6a4d0e 311b8b02036e7df 928b998339
Author: Lukas Bezdicka <email address hidden>
Date: Tue Apr 7 00:12:03 2020 +0200
Properly place undercloud hosts record upgrade task
Undercloud record for hosts has to be in all the nodes that fetch Prepare it runs on the
images from it. Proper location for this code is where we set up
podman. If it's only in ContainerImages
Controller role only.
Closes-Bug: #1871243
Change-Id: Id081f049bca6c9 61ad2ff649ac357 cea8d552739